West Virginia High School Football - Parkersburg Catholic sneaks past Ritchie County
September 1, 2018: Parkersburg, WV 26104 The Parkersburg Catholic Crusaders football squad scored 32 points and restricted the visiting Ritchie County Rebels to 28 in the Crusaders league victory on Saturday.
The Crusaders now possess a 2-0 record. They put it on the line next when they host South Harrison for a Little Kanawha battle on Friday, September 7. Parkersburg Catholic will face a Hawks squad coming off a 58-7 non-league loss to Point Pleasant (Point Pleasant, WV). The Hawks record now stands at 0-2.
Coming up next, the Rebels face the Frontier Cougars (New Matamoras, OH) in a non-league battle, on Friday, September 7. Ritchie County will attempt to advance on its 1-1 season record. The Cougars enter the battle with a 1-1 record after their 61-6 non-league win over Beallsville (Beallsville, OH).
